#4761
Eroul nostru, Mao, a ajuns în Crângul de Bambuși din Universul Paralel unde înălțimile tulpinilor de bambus sunt amețitoare. În crângul din acest univers se află n
tulpini de înălțimi h[1]
, h[2]
, …, h[n]
. Mao are nevoie să taie cel puțin M
metri de bambus, așa că el procedează astfel: își alege o înălțime H
și trece pe la fiecare tulpină în parte. Dacă bambusul i
are înălțimea h[i]
mai mare decât H
, atunci taie din el partea de sus astfel încât să rămână exact H
metri, iar dacă bambusul are cel mult H
metri, atunci nu taie deloc. Să se determine înălțimea maximă H
pe care o poate fixa Mao astfel încât după tăiere să poată pleca acasă cu cel puțin M
metri de bambus.
Problema | bambusi | Operații I/O |
![]() bambusi.in /bambusi.out
|
---|---|---|---|
Limita timp | 0.4 secunde | Limita memorie |
Total: 64 MB
/
Stivă 8 MB
|
Id soluție | #56970161 | Utilizator | |
Fișier | bambusi.cpp | Dimensiune | 828 B |
Data încărcării | 12 Martie 2025, 08:40 | Scor / rezultat | Eroare de compilare |
bambusi.cpp: In function 'int main()': bambusi.cpp:15:17: error: invalid types 'int[int]' for array subscript cin>>v[i]; ^ bambusi.cpp:16:15: error: invalid types 'int[int]' for array subscript if(v[i]>dr) ^ bambusi.cpp:17:19: error: invalid types 'int[int]' for array subscript dr=v[i]; ^ bambusi.cpp:21:5: error: 'st' was not declared in this scope st=0; ^ bambusi.cpp:24:9: error: 'mij' was not declared in this scope mij=(st+dr)/2; ^ bambusi.cpp:30:19: error: invalid types 'int[int]' for array subscript if(v[i]>mij) ^ bambusi.cpp:31:23: error: invalid types 'int[int]' for array subscript S+=v[i]-mij; ^ bambusi.cpp:37:17: error: 'H' was not declared in this scope H=mij; ^ bambusi.cpp:41:11: error: 'H' was not declared in this scope cout<<H; ^
www.pbinfo.ro permite evaluarea a două tipuri de probleme:
Problema bambusi face parte din prima categorie. Soluția propusă de tine va fi evaluată astfel:
Suma punctajelor acordate pe testele utilizate pentru verificare este 100. Astfel, soluția ta poate obține cel mult 100 de puncte, caz în care se poate considera corectă.